In actuality, steam extraction techniques are used to extract 93% of all essential oils. Other common extraction techniques include enfleurage (particularly used with roses), cold …

Methods for Extracting Essential Oils

The most commonly used extraction method is the steam distillation or water distillation method (Figure 1).This extraction process can last between 1 and 10 h.The amount of oil produced depends on length of distillation time, temperature, pressure, and type of plant material (Naves, 1974).During distillation, plant materials are exposed to …

Review on essential oil extraction from aromatic and medicinal plants

The methods used to extract essential oil from these plants are; steam distillation (SD), solvent-assisted extraction, hydro distillation (HD), ... Four main types of equipment are used in the steam distillation process: boiler, distillation unit, condenser, and florentine flask.
